The Principles Behind Essential Oil Massage

aromatherapy mind body relaxation

Aromatherapy massage integrates the therapeutic benefits of essential oils with the physiological effects of manual massage techniques.

At its core, this approach harnesses the volatile compounds found in plant-derived oils, which are absorbed through the skin and inhaled during treatment. The limbic system, responsible for emotion and memory, responds to olfactory stimuli, facilitating emotional relaxation and psychological comfort.

Key Essential Oils Used in Our Treatments

A core component of Spa & Massage’s aromatherapy treatments is the careful selection of pure essential oils, each chosen for specific therapeutic properties.

Lavender oil is selected for its evidence-based anxiolytic and sedative effects, fostering deep relaxation. Eucalyptus oil, renowned for its decongestant and anti-inflammatory properties, supports respiratory comfort and physical ease. Sweet orange oil is utilised for its documented mood-enhancing and uplifting qualities, gently invigorating the senses.

Geranium oil, valued for its balancing effect on mood and skin health, is integrated to promote emotional harmony. These oils are diluted in carrier oils to guarantee ideal dermal absorption and safety.

Therapist Techniques and Approach

Following a thorough consultation and essential oil selection, aromatic massage at Spa & Massage is executed through methodical, rhythmical strokes designed to optimise both the absorption of botanical oils and neuromuscular relaxation.

Therapists employ a blend of effleurage, petrissage, and gentle pressure tailored to each client’s needs and preferences. These techniques facilitate enhanced peripheral circulation, promote lymphatic drainage, and support the even distribution of essential oils across the skin’s surface.

Tailoring Massage Techniques

Recognising that each individual presents with distinct therapeutic needs and physiological responses, Spa & Massage therapists employ a variety of tailored massage techniques to maximise the effects of aromatherapy.

Techniques are selected based on client preferences, target areas, and desired outcomes—whether alleviating muscular tension, promoting lymphatic drainage, or enhancing relaxation. For example, gentle effleurage is often integrated to facilitate ideal absorption of essential oils through the skin, while deeper petrissage may address specific muscular adhesions.

Therapists continuously assess tissue response and client feedback, adjusting pressure and rhythm accordingly.

Aftercare and Recommendations From Our Therapists

Following an aromatic massage, appropriate aftercare is essential to optimise therapeutic outcomes and prolong the benefits of treatment.

At Spa & Massage, therapists recommend clients remain well-hydrated to facilitate the elimination of metabolic byproducts mobilised during massage. Rest is encouraged to support the body’s natural recuperative processes. Clients are advised to avoid vigorous activity and allow the aromatic oils to remain on the skin for several hours; this enables continued absorption and maximises the physiological effects of essential oils.

Gentle stretching or mindful breathing can further augment relaxation and maintain supple musculature.
